Daley Peters (Winnipeg, MB) qualified for the 2012 MCT Championships playoffs, dropping their quarterfinals match 6-3 against William Lyburn (Winnipeg, MB).
 
Peters finished 3-2 in the 16-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Peters lost 6-5 to Bob Sigurdson (Winnipeg, MB), then responded with a 7-2 win over Dennis Bohn (Winnipeg, MB). Peters won 8-6 against Kyle Doering (Winnipeg, MB). Peters went on to lose 5-0 against Sean Grassie (Winnipeg, MB). Peters responded with a 7-5 win over Bohn in their final qualifying round match.
 
Peters earned 0.750 world rankings points for their Top 5 finish in the MCT Championships, moving up 1 spots the World Ranking Standings into 97th place overall with 14.622 total points. Peters ranks 87th overall on the Year-to-Date rankings with 8.041 points earned so far this season.
